Materials Today 2013 v.16 №05 May
Elsevier Ltd. — 68 p. — ISSN: 1369-7021.
«Materials Today» is the gateway to materials science for all researchers with an interest in materials science and technology. Both in the journal and on the website, it is our mission to make the most important findings from across materials science accessible to as many researchers as possible. In the journal, in print and online, you'll find peer-refereed review and research articles that assess the latest findings and examine the future challenges, as well as comment and opinion pieces from leading scientists discussing issues at the forefront of materials science.
High performance bulk thermoelectrics via a panoscopic approach.
J. He, M. G. Kanatzidis and V.P. Dravid.
Evolving strategies for preventing biofilm on implantable materials.
F. K. Kasper, A. G. Mikos et al.
The ß relaxation in metallic glasses: an overview.
H-B. Yu, W-H. Wang and K. Samwer et al.
The potential of rapid cooling spark plasma sintering for metallic materials.
F. Zhang et al.
